Episode Synopsis
In this episode of the Noble American Lives Podcast, host William H. Benson completes his biography of Joseph Smith, the founder of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-Day Saints. The episode details the events leading up to and following Joseph Smith's assassination, including the transport and secretive burial of his and his brother Hiram's bodies, and the subsequent actions and beliefs of his surviving family members, particularly Emma Smith. The podcast also explores the complex issue of polygamy in Mormon history, supported by a list of Joseph Smith's additional wives, and details the eventual migration of Brigham Young and the Mormons to Utah.
